Offline Homeassistant-solar-forecast-and-battery-state-forecast

Buy Me A Coffee

Homeassistant solar battery charge prediction with display card. Works plug and play with the modbus sungrow integration for HA (https://github.com/mkaiser/Sungrow-SHx-Inverter-Modbus-Home-Assistant)

Features

all features are tested and only approximate real circumstances!

  • fully offline!
  • predict battery state at evening after charging
  • predict battery state at morning after decharging
  • predict battery charging time
  • predict minimum charge needed to get over night
  • predict time left of solar
  • predict start of charging
  • example lovelace card (mushroom required)

Installation

please contribute ANY upgrades to the card or algorythm thia helps everybody!

  1. copy all files oft the battery-predict.yaml into your custom yaml integrations folder
  2. make changes for your individual setup (set entity ids battery size, avg consumtion...)
  3. copy the card as a manual yaml config into lovelace. !mushroom required!
  4. edit the current production of solar entity in the conditional cards
